Sandra Hetzl (born 1980 in Munich) studied Visual Culture Studies at Berlin University of the Arts and translated contemporary Arabic literature into German. Her translations include works by Rasha Abbas, Kadhem Khanjar, Aref Hamza, Bushra al-Maktari and Assaf Alassaf; together with Kerstin Wilsch, she translated the collection “Poems from Guantánamo” (2022). Hetzl also co-edited the anthology “In der Zukunft schwelgen” (2022). She founded the 10/11 collective for contemporary Arabic literature and the Downtown Spandau Medina literature festival.
